Output d5c3238c663ece3987df6084a5130f510d44b96eac51900c2fc4971498035763:0

value
1023185
script pubkey
OP_0 OP_PUSHBYTES_20 3fb4bc9c34a5dc7008fd18824193ab19a58595ee
address
bc1q876te8p55hw8qz8arzpyryatrxjct90wnk509h
transaction
d5c3238c663ece3987df6084a5130f510d44b96eac51900c2fc4971498035763
spent
true